Object detection; MLPerf inference; TensorFlow CPU; COCO; 50 images validation; Raspberry Pi; benchmark; Portable Workflows
Component: cr-solution:demo-obj-detection-coco-tf-cpu-benchmark-rpi-portable-workflows (v1.3.0)
Added by: gfursin (2019-12-29 21:48:55)
Creation date: 2019-12-22 11:43:25
CID: 1dde4902b05ae08f:70ec4885b4735633cr-solution:demo-obj-detection-coco-tf-cpu-benchmark-rpi-portable-workflows  )

Sign up here to be notified when new results are reproduced or new CodeReef components are shared!


Related paper: MLPerf Inference Benchmark
Related and reproduced results (crowd-experiments): sota-mlperf-object-detection-v0.5-crowd-benchmarking
How to get stable CodeReef version (under development):
  pip install codereef
  cr init demo-obj-detection-coco-tf-cpu-benchmark-rpi-portable-workflows
  cr run demo-obj-detection-coco-tf-cpu-benchmark-rpi-portable-workflows
  # If benchmarking is supported:
  cr benchmark demo-obj-detection-coco-tf-cpu-benchmark-rpi-portable-workflows
Portable CK workflow:
  ck run program:object-detection-tf-py-benchmark --cmd_key=default
Host OS: linux-32 (Raspbian GNU/Linux 10 (buster))
Target OS: linux-32 (Raspbian GNU/Linux 10 (buster))
Target machine: Raspberry (Raspberry Pi 4 Model B Rev 1.1)
Target CPU: BCM2835
Target CPUs:
Target GPU:
Python version for virtual env:

CodeReef client connection cr start



Dependencies on other components


Prerequisites for further automation:
   # Tested on Raspberry Pi 4
   
   # These dependencies are needed to rebuild COCO API:
   
    sudo apt update
    sudo apt install git wget libz-dev curl cmake
    sudo apt install gcc g++ autoconf autogen libtool
    sudo apt install libfreetype6-dev
    sudo apt install python3.7-dev
    sudo apt install -y libsm6 libxext6 libxrender-dev
   

      
cr download --version=1.0.0 --force package:model-tf-mlperf-ssd-mobilenet cr download --version=1.0.0 --force soft:model.tensorflow.object-detection cr download --version=1.0.0 --force script:install-package-tensorflowmodel-object-detection cr download --version=1.0.0 --force package:lib-python-numpy cr download --version=1.0.0 --force soft:lib.python.numpy cr download --version=1.0.0 --force package:lib-python-scipy cr download --version=1.0.0 --force soft:lib.python.scipy cr download --version=1.0.0 --force package:lib-python-matplotlib cr download --version=1.0.0 --force soft:lib.python.matplotlib cr download --version=1.0.0 --force package:lib-python-pillow cr download --version=1.0.0 --force soft:lib.python.pillow cr download --version=1.0.0 --force package:lib-python-cython cr download --version=1.0.0 --force soft:lib.python.cython cr download --version=1.0.0 --force package:lib-python-cv2 cr download --version=1.0.0 --force soft:lib.python.cv2 cr download --version=1.0.0 --force package:tool-coco-codereef cr download --version=1.0.0 --force soft:tool.coco cr download --version=1.0.0 --force package:dataset-coco-2017-val-small cr download --version=1.0.0 --force soft:dataset.coco.2017.val cr download --version=1.0.2 --force package:lib-tensorflow-1.1.0-cpu cr download --version=1.0.0 --force package:lib-tensorflow-1.4.0-cpu cr download --version=1.0.0 --force package:lib-tensorflow-1.13.1-cpu cr download --version=1.0.0 --force package:lib-tensorflow-1.14.0-cpu cr download --version=1.0.0 --force soft:lib.tensorflow cr download --version=1.0.1 --force package:lib-tensorflow-pip cr download --version=1.0.0 --force soft:lib.python.tensorflow cr download --version=1.0.0 --force package:labelmap-coco cr download --version=1.0.0 --force soft:labelmap.object-detection cr download --version=1.0.0 --force soft:compiler.gcc cr download --version=1.0.0 --force package:tensorflowmodel-api-object-detection cr download --version=1.0.0 --force soft:model.tensorflow-models-api cr download --version=1.0.0 --force package:lib-protobuf-3.0.0-host cr download --version=1.0.0 --force soft:lib.protobuf.host cr download --version=1.0.0 --force script:process-compiler-for-cmake cr download --version=1.0.0 --force soft:tool.cmake cr download --version=1.0.0 --force soft:lib.protobuf.host cr download --version=1.0.1 --force module:program cr download --version=1.0.0 --force module:dataset cr download --version=1.0.0 --force module:pipeline cr download --version=1.0.0 --force module:choice cr download --version=1.0.0 --force module:experiment cr download --version=1.0.0 --force module:math.variation cr download --version=1.4.0 --force program:object-detection-tf-py-benchmark #ck install package:lib-tensorflow-pip --env.PACKAGE_VERSION=1.14.0 # Doens't install PIL needed further (1.13.1 package installs it) #ck install package:lib-tensorflow-1.13.1-cpu --env.VIA_PYPI --env.ALLOW_ALL_BITS ck install package:lib-tensorflow-1.14.0-cpu --env.VIA_PYPI --env.ALLOW_ALL_BITS ck install package --tags=model,tf,object-detection,mlperf,ssd-mobilenet,non-quantized ck install package --tags=lib,python-package,numpy ck install package --tags=lib,python-package,scipy --force_version=1.2.1 ck install package --tags=lib,python-package,matplotlib ck install package --tags=lib,python-package,pillow ck install package --tags=lib,python-package,cython ck install package --tags=lib,python-package,cv2,opencv-contrib-python --force_version=3.4.3.18 ck install package:tool-coco-codereef ck install package:dataset-coco-2017-val-small


All versions:


All files (click to download):


Public comments

    Please log in to add your comment!


If you notice inapropriate content that should not be here, please report us as soon as possible and we will try to remove it within 48 hours!